        The move of Don to the A's may have been a 
welcome sight for some, but for me it meant not 
knowing which wheel to follow up Ringwood.  Also, 
not having an entertaining race report.
        Anyway, about 17 B riders rode rather 
conservatively down Midline.  Even Mark Rishniw 
didn't seem interested in pushing the pace.  It 
was a moderate pace up Hurd with 11 cresting the 
top together.  I think people were saving 
themselves for the impending climbs ahead.
        This group stayed together back down 
Midline with a couple half-hearted attacks up 
Ellis Hollow Creek Rd.   The bottom part of 
Ringwood was rather uneventful until Shan 
Mouhiddin picked up the tempo.  This lead to a 
stringing out of the field and audible groans from 
Twinkie.
       As Shan tired, Mark Shenstone attacked, 
taking Garrett Graham (summer temp. from Ashville, 
NC) with him.  Felix and Dave H. couldn't keep 
pace and were about 40 meters back as the other 
two topped Ringwood.  Felix and Dave worked 
together to catch Mark half-way to the Mt. 
Pleasant turn.  Mark's fatigued legs, both from 
the Owasco race and Monday's polo match, kept him 
from latching on.   The two caught Garrett 100m 
onto Mt. Pleasant.  These 3 crested the 
penultimate hill together and tore down the other 
side.  Dave's legs gave out half-way up the final 
climb.  Felix and Garrett were neck and neck to 
the finish, with Felix taking the win and Garrett 
2nd, Dave 3rd and Mark 4th (I think).  I'm not 
sure who came in 5th.
        The heat didn't bother me much until 
Ringwood.  Overall, a good race and good workout.
